在Excel中计算差值并统计大于1的数量
在使用Excel进行数据分析时,经常需要计算两列数据之间的差值,并统计大于某一特定值的个数。以下是如何通过Excel的函数进行这一操作的详细步骤。
步骤一:计算差值
首先,在C2单元格中输入公式=A2-B2,这将计算A列和B列对应单元格的差值。输入公式后,可以通过拖动填充手柄,向下复制该公式,从而快速计算C列其他单元格的差值。
步骤二:统计差值大于1的个数
接下来,在C1单元格中输入如下公式以统计大于1的数量:=COUNTIF(C2:C12,">1")。执行此步骤后,C1单元格将显示C列中大于1的差值个数。

公式解读
在该公式中,COUNTIF函数用于统计满足特定条件的单元格个数。具体来说,=COUNTIF(C2:C12,">1")函数的含义如下:
- 查找范围是C2到C12。
- 查找条件为大于1,注意此条件必须用双引号括起来。
步骤三:使用SUM函数实现数组计算
如果你想避免在中间使用C列进行计算,可以使用数组公式。在D1单元格输入如下公式:=SUM(((A2:A12-B2:B12)>1)*1),然后按下Ctrl+Shift+Enter,返回的结果会在公式外部生成大括号({}),表示该公式为数组公式。
公式解析
该数组公式的解释如下:
- SUM函数用于对数据进行求和。
- 通过按下Ctrl+Shift+Enter,将进行数组计算。公式实际计算为:=SUM(((A2-B2)>1)*1,((A3-B3)>1)*1,...)
- 逻辑运算的结果为布尔值,乘以1后转为数字参与求和。
- 可以利用Excel的公式求值功能,观察求值的逐步过程。
步骤四:IF函数的应用
另一个不依赖于第三列的计算方法是在E1单元格中输入以下公式:=SUM(IF((A2:A12-B2:B12)>1,1,0)),同样需要通过Ctrl+Shift+Enter激活数组功能。
公式含义
该公式的理解过程如下:
- 使用SUM函数求和,IF函数用于逻辑条件判断。
- 数组计算结果同样会通过大括号标识。
- IF函数会返回1(如果条件成立),否则返回0。
总结
通过以上步骤,可以有效地使用Excel进行数据差值计算并统计结果。这些技巧不仅可以提高工作效率,还能帮助你更好地理解数据分析的基本操作。